Joburg Water on drive to fix all damaged pipes, starting with Soweto, Alexandra

Joburg Water has announced that it will intensify its efforts to repair or replace aging and obsolete water infrastructure in Soweto, Orange Farm and Alexandra.

This will reduce water losses owing to leaks – the entity lost about 38% of its bulk supply in 2019 owing to damaged infrastructure.

The repairs form part of Joburg Water’s Pipes Replacement Programme, which is under way across Johannesburg to substitute all damaged water pipes.

Joburg Water has more than 10 000 km of distribution pipes providing water across the city.

The entity assures that it will limit supply interruptions for residents when maintenance is conducted.
